| Figures update 15,000 reported dead with a further 15,000 missing. More than 15,000 people were killed in a devastating cyclone that hit western Burma on Saturday, Foreign Minister Nyan Win has said on state TV. He said his government was ready to accept international assistance, and aid shipments were now being prepared. Thousands of survivors of Cyclone Nargis are lacking shelter, drinking water, power and communications, but in many regions help has not yet arrived. Five regions in which 24 million people live have been declared disaster zones. Expressing his sadness at the scale of the disaster, UN Secretary General Ban Ki-moon confirmed that UN officials were meeting Burmese government representatives to discuss how to help. If the toll is confirmed, Nargis is now the world's deadliest storm since a 1999 cyclone in India killed 10,000 people. Nargis hit the south-east Asian country on Saturday with wind speeds reaching 190km/h (120mph). | Re: Nargis deadliest storm this century The World Food Programme has halted aid shipments to Burma after the contents of its first delivery were impounded on arrival in the military-ruled country. The UN body says the Burmese government seized tonnes of aid material flown in to help victims of Cyclone Nargis, which has killed tens of thousands. The WFP said it had no choice but to halt aid until the matter was resolved. Burma's ruling generals have faced mounting criticism over their handling of the crisis. The UN fears more than 1.5 million people have been affected by the cyclone, with tens of thousands made homeless and vulnerable to disease.
